In vivo methods for evaluating human midpalatal suture maturation and ossification: An updated review.

Abstract

OBJECTIVES

The aim of this study was to perform an updated review of the in vivo methods to evaluate human midpalatal suture maturation and ossification, since this evaluation process remains an unsolved and critical problem in orthodontic treatment.

MATERIALS AND METHODS

PubMed, Embase, Cochrane Library, Scopus and Web of Science databases were searched up to November 30, 2021. Literature selection was conducted according to the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A, 2020 Edition) statement and was based on predetermined inclusion criteria. The overall and methodological characteristics of the selected studies were collected. The risk of bias was evaluated mainly through inter- and intra-evaluator agreement outcomes reported in each study. As there was a high heterogeneity among methodological studies, meta-analysis of the included studies was not applicable, and results were analysed descriptively.

RESULTS

Nine articles met the inclusion criteria. Maxillary occlusal radiograph and computed tomography (CT), especially cone beam CT (CBCT), were reported. The occlusal radiograph is not adequate for evaluating the status of midpalatal suture maturation, and has been replaced by CBCT. Qualitative and quantitative CBCT evaluation methods provide limited evidence; however, opinions differ regarding the efficacy of these methods.

CONCLUSIONS

For midpalatal suture maturation and ossification status evaluation, evidence for the current methods is still limited. Further methodological studies should use image information comprehensively and provide verification evidence on larger samples.

摘要

目的

本研究旨在对评估人类正中缝成熟和骨化的体内方法进行更新综述,因为在正畸治疗中,这种评估过程仍然是一个未解决的关键问题。

材料与方法

检索了 PubMed、Embase、Cochrane 图书馆、Scopus 和 Web of Science 数据库,截至 2021 年 11 月 30 日。文献选择按照系统评价和荟萃分析的首选报告项目(PRISMA,2020 年版)声明进行,并基于预定的纳入标准。收集了所选研究的总体和方法学特征。主要通过每项研究报告的观察者间和观察者内一致性结果来评估偏倚风险。由于方法学研究之间存在高度异质性,因此不适用纳入研究的荟萃分析,结果进行描述性分析。

结果

符合纳入标准的文章有 9 篇。报道了上颌牙合片和计算机断层扫描(CT),特别是锥形束 CT(CBCT)。牙合片不适合评估正中缝成熟状态,已被 CBCT 取代。定性和定量 CBCT 评估方法提供的证据有限;然而,对于这些方法的效果存在不同意见。

结论

对于正中缝成熟和骨化状态的评估,目前方法的证据仍然有限。进一步的方法学研究应综合使用图像信息,并在更大的样本中提供验证证据。
